What are the six main crystalline structures of silicate minerals?

Silicate minerals are the most common of Earth’s minerals and include quartz, feldspar, mica, amphibole, pyroxene, and olivine. Silica tetrahedra, made up of silicon and oxygen, form chains, sheets, and frameworks, and bond with other cations to form silicate minerals.

Is Muscovite a silicate mineral?

Muscovite, also called common mica, potash mica, or isinglass, abundant silicate mineral that contains potassium and aluminum. Muscovite is the most common member of the mica group. Because of its perfect cleavage, it can occur in thin, transparent, but durable sheets.

How many common minerals are there?

There are currently nearly 5000 minerals known to science, but only a few dozen are common enough to be found widespread throughout the Earth’s crust.
